## Rotation: nightly backfill scheduler (Dunecart)

Rotated deploy key for the Dunecart scheduler that kicks off nightly data backfills at 02:10. Old key revoked; jobs signed with it will fail verification and skip, not retry. If tonight's backfill stalls, check the signer first, then the queue. No schedule changes. No config changes beyond the key swap. Runbook steps unchanged. Alert thresholds unchanged. On-call action required only if two consecutive runs skip. Current signing key follows.

deploy key for hawef-yadup: bky19_kVT4YunTZZSTyhFQQoK

## Vramscope Environments

Vramscope profiles GPU memory on the Lanterfall render fleet. Three environments: dev, staging, prod. Staging mirrors prod card types; dev runs on shared partitions only. Profiling daemons sample every 250ms in prod, 50ms elsewhere. Release manager must confirm the sampler version matches the driver baseline before each cut. Dumps land in the Kestrelbay bucket, rotated weekly. The staging profiler runs with the following configuration values.

service settings:
ZORWYN_HOST=zorwyn.tolvaqsys.internal
ZORWYN_PORT=4000

/*
 * Fixture: relevance_tuning_baseline.json
 * Captures Quillmark search rankings after the 2024-Q3 synonym
 * expansion for the Harrowfield catalog. If nightly scoring drifts
 * more than 0.05 NDCG, re-run the tuner before paging anyone —
 * it is usually a stale embedding cache. The refresh job calls
 * the Quillmark admin API using the bearer token directly below.
 */

login token, hawef-kahof: eyJhbGciOiJIUzI1NiIsInR5cCI6IkpXVCJ9.eyJzdWIiOiIxQ8nm1In0.OfwP90Sx

## Ticket: Nightly reindex failing — expired credentials

The Brindlewood nightly search reindex has failed since Tuesday with 401s against the Corvane index service. The job's credential expired and was never added to the rotation schedule. This change swaps in a freshly issued key and registers it with the Haleford rotator. For review, the replacement key is below.

gateway credential: kto23_LX9A4ys6i4nzHtpOLNLodKK